1. This document appears to be an exam for a Business Law course, consisting of multiple choice and short answer questions. 2. The exam is divided into two parts - multiple choice questions worth 90 points in Part I, and short answer questions in Part II. 3. The multiple choice questions cover topics like definitions of law, the nature and functions of law, sources of law in Ethiopia, types of law like public law, and elements of contracts.
